Man City vs. Leicester City Livestream: How to Watch Premier League Soccer From Anywhere

A baptism of fire awaits new Leicester City boss Dean Smith, as his relegation-threatened side travel to the Etihad to take on a Manchester City side in blistering form.

Smith comes in for Brendan Rogers, who was sacked following a run of bad form that has seen the Foxes slip to second bottom in the English Premier League table, with relegation now looking a very real prospect.

The former Aston Villa boss kicks off his reign with arguably the toughest challenge in English football as he looks to secure some much-needed points away against a team that has its sights set on toppling EPL leaders Arsenal.

The hosts are on a superb run of nine straight wins across all competitions, the latest a hugely impressive 3-0 home victory against German giants Bayern Munich in the UEFA Champions League on Tuesday. Man City have won every home game so far in 2023, and scored 25 goals in their last five games.

Manchester City vs. Leicester City: When and where?

Man City host Leicester at the Etihad Stadium on Saturday, April 15. Kickoff is set for 5:30 p.m. BST local time in the UK (12:30 p.m. ET, 9:30 a.m. PT in the US, and at 3:30 a.m. AEST on Sunday, April 16 in Australia).

Livestream the Man City vs. Leicester City game in the UK

Premier League rights in the UK are split between Sky Sports, BT Sport and Amazon Prime Video. This game is exclusive to Sky Sports — showing on its Sky Sports Main Event, Premier League and Ultra channels. If you already have Sky Sports as part of your TV package, you can stream the game via its Sky Go app, but cord-cutters will want to get set up with a Now account, and a Now Sports membership, to stream the game.

Sky subsidiary Now (formerly Now TV) offers streaming access to Sky Sports channels with a Now Sports membership. You can get a day of access for 12, or sign up to a monthly plan from 21 per month right now.
